egg chair in chromed metal, created by italian designer gastone rinaldi, a key figure in italian design of the 1960s and 70s. This iconic model perfectly illustrates rinaldi's approach, renowned for his experimental work with wire and tubular steel structures, blending visual lightness, sculptural lines, and comfortable use.
the openwork seat, made of chromed metal wire, creates an enveloping and organic shape reminiscent of the iconic egg chair silhouette. The transparency of the structure visually lightens the chair while asserting a strong graphic presence. The sled base in chromed tubular steel, with its continuous and balanced curves, reinforces the modernist aesthetic and ensures excellent stability.
this chair is representative of vintage italian design from the second half of the 20th century, a period during which metal became a central material in contemporary furniture. The interplay of lines, voids, and reflections lends this piece an almost architectural dimension, both elegant and timeless.
